Peter Berresford Ellis

Peter Berresford Ellis (born 1943) is a British writer, historian and novelist.

Also recorded as Peter Tremayne; Peter MacAlan; P. Berresford Ellis.

Overview

Also worked under the name Peter MacAlan and Peter Tremayne.

Born at Coventry in 1943.

In detail

Peter Berresford Ellis studied at University of East London and University of London. the recorded working language is English.

Subjects and genres recorded for the work are horror.

Membership is recorded of Royal Historical Society and Gorsedh Kernow.

Distinctions recorded are Fellow of the Royal Historical Society.
